About Middlesex County:

Middlesex County is a vibrant upper-tier municipality located in Southwestern Ontario. We offer a thriving business climate, easy access to transportation routes, and quality of life. Middlesex County offers residents easy commutes, safe communities, a diverse economy, exceptional healthcare facilities, affordable housing, an array of educational opportunities and bountiful recreation and cultural choices in a picturesque setting. The County's administration headquarters are located in London, but Middlesex County is comprised of unique villages, towns and rural communities that have great attractions for residents and tourists.

Position Overview:

Reporting to the Director and/or Manager of Planning & Development, the Planning Student is responsible for assisting with a full range of planning functions, development projects and processes to support Middlesex County's land use planning function. Responsibilities will include researching and assisting with the preparation of reports, providing general operational support to the Department, responding to inquiries, and organizing meetings. This position is based at the County Administration Building, located at 399 Ridout St. N. in London, Ontario.

Responsibilities:



Supports the Planners in the review and processing of development-related applications Assists with maintaining all paper and digital files on development applications in accordance with established protocols Generates planning documents, including but not limited to, manuals and procedures Provides support on various development projects by performing related research and assisting with the preparation of reports Organize meetings, as well as provide excellent customer service by responding to general inquiries Perform additional duties and undertake special projects as assigned

Qualifications:



Currently enrolled in post-secondary education in a Planning Program or a related discipline Demonstrated verbal and written (including report writing) communication skills Excellent research, analytical, organizational, and time management skills Proficiency in Microsoft Office and internet software Excellent customer service skills with the ability to use tact and diplomacy to interact courteously and effectively with the public Knowledge of the Planning Act or other relevant statutory documents, Provincial Policy, and planning processes, is an asset Valid driver's licence and use of a vehicle
